A marriage made in Italy

Winters, Rebecca. (Author). LaVecchia, Antoinette. (Narrator). Recorded Books, Inc. (Added Author).

Summary: A brooding Italian With a dark family history, single dad Leon Malatesta is determined to keep his baby daughter out of the headlines. And so, when a striking woman starts asking questions around the sun-kissed town of Rimini, Leon's protective instinct goes into overdrive. and a mysterious beauty! Only, Belle Peterson turns out to be the long-lost daughter of his stepmother! Her innocence touches Leon's locked-away heart in a way he never believed possible after losing his wife. Now Belle brings the possibility of a new future for them all if only he can convince her he wants to marry her for love, not just to give them all the family they want so much
